| Product Name | Squamous Cell Carcinoma Antigen (SCC) ELISA Kit |
| Catalog No. | TMTR-HMM-0060 |
| Description | A quantitative sandwich enzyme immunoassay for the measurement of SCC antigen in human serum, supporting clinical monitoring of squamous cell carcinomas of the cervix, lung, esophagus, and head and neck. |
| Intended Use | Quantitative serum SCC antigen measurement for monitoring therapeutic response and detecting recurrence in patients with squamous cell carcinoma of various primary sites. |
| Principle / Technology | Sandwich ELISA utilizing monoclonal antibodies that recognize both SCCA1 and SCCA2 isoforms of the serine protease inhibitor (serpin) family. |
| Detection Method | Spectrophotometric measurement at 450 nm |
| Sample Type | Human serum; skin contamination of the specimen must be avoided |
| Performance Range / Specifications | 0.3–50 ng/mL standard curve range |
| Sensitivity / LOD | ≤0.1 ng/mL minimum detectable concentration |
| Specificity | Detection of both acidic (SCCA2) and neutral (SCCA1) isoforms; no cross-reactivity with other serpin family members at physiological concentrations |
| Reaction Conditions / Protocol | 90-minute sample incubation at 37°C, followed by sequential 60-minute detection antibody, 30-minute enzyme conjugate, and 20-minute substrate development incubations |
| Components / Formulation | Anti-SCC antibody-coated 96-well plate, SCC antigen standards (5 concentrations plus zero), HRP-conjugated detection antibody, TMB substrate, stop solution, wash buffer concentrate, sample diluent |
| Storage Conditions | 2–8°C; reconstituted standard stable for 7 days at 2–8°C |
| Shelf Life | 12 months |
| Package Specifications | 96 tests |
| Product Form | Pre-coated plate with liquid reagents |
| Quality Control | Intra-assay CV below 7%; inter-assay CV below 9%; dilution linearity 95–105% |
| Key Features | Dual isoform detection ensures comprehensive SCC antigen measurement across SCCA1 and SCCA2 variants; validated reference range supports clinical interpretation for multiple squamous cell carcinoma indications |
